Understanding AI in Crypto Analysis

AI, in the context of financial markets, refers to algorithms designed to perform tasks that typically require human intelligence, such as learning, problem-solving, and decision-making. In crypto, this translates to analyzing price action, news sentiment, blockchain data, and even social media trends to predict potential market movements. Machine learning, a subset of AI, is particularly relevant, as it allows systems to learn from data without explicit programming.

Sentiment Analysis Tools

One of the most accessible AI applications is sentiment analysis. These tools scan news articles, social media posts, and forums to gauge the overall mood surrounding specific cryptocurrencies or the market at large. A predominantly positive sentiment might suggest bullish momentum, while widespread negative sentiment could signal potential downturns. Platforms often integrate such data, allowing traders to view sentiment scores directly alongside market charts. Predictive Modeling

More sophisticated AI models aim to predict future price movements by analyzing historical data, economic indicators, and on-chain metrics. While no AI can guarantee perfect predictions, these models can provide probabilistic outcomes, highlighting potential support and resistance levels or forecasting the likelihood of price increases or decreases within specific timeframes. Understanding the confidence levels associated with these predictions is crucial for effective use.

Risk Management with AI

AI can also play a role in risk management. By analyzing historical volatility and correlation patterns, AI can help traders set more appropriate stop-loss levels or diversify their portfolios more effectively. Understanding the risk parameters suggested by AI tools can lead to more robust trading strategies.
